Vakhitov–Kolokolov stability criterion

The Vakhitov–Kolokolov stability criterion is a condition used in the study of nonlinear wave phenomena, particularly in the stability analysis of solitary waves or pulses in various physical systems, such as nonlinear optics and fluid dynamics. The criterion helps determine whether a given solitary wave solution to a nonlinear partial differential equation is stable or unstable under small perturbations.
